Replica Watches: Your Questions Answered (Legality, Quality, & More)

Considering purchasing a duplicate watch? You're probably not alone. Many people are intrigued about these imitations of luxury timepieces. Let’s explore some typical questions. Legally, owning a replica watch is generally legal for private use in many places; however, shipping or distributing them is usually against the law due to copyright concerns. Quality can fluctuate widely; while some offer reasonable craftsmanship and trustworthy movements, others are shoddily made with low-grade materials. Ultimately, knowing these nuances is crucial before reaching a judgment.
